How mailing lists work on my site
Because of the wide variety of genres I write in these days, I decided to not inflict unwanted information on readers who only read one genre or the other. I divided my large mailing list into two smaller lists–one for contemporary and one for paranormal (science fiction romance, fantasy romance, and paranormal romance).
I genuinely, sincerely only want you to hear about the books and series you love.
You may unsubscribe at any time by following the link at the bottom of any email you receive from me.
I am always happy to take suggestions about the value of the email you receive. You can write me back at the address included in the email and send me any feedback you want.

Disclaimer about Mailing List Website Signup Form
It is not practical to put two signup forms all over my website so I had to come up with a way to have one on most of it. The website signup form on my website asks for genre-specific information.
This initial list is a little different than my “real” mailing lists. On a regular basis, I sort those website signups by your answers and move readers into either the contemporary mailing list, the paranormal mailing list, or both if a reader answers yes to both questions.
The website mailing list stays at zero subscribers and is not used for actual mail. It is just a simple way to help me sort you since I don’t have a sorting hat like Hogwartz does in the Harry Potter novels.

Cookies
Unfortunately, we’re not talking about the yummy kind of cookies here. A cookie on a website is a little bit of code that collects info from the person browsing the site. My website uses cookies to see which of my pages and books you guys like the best and things like what browsers you use (so I can make things look all nice and snazzy whatever you’re using!)
Cookies cannot know any personal information by themselves, you would have to enter that information onto the website they reside on and I do not use any tracking cookies, so basically you leave my site and I wave goodbye. I don’t have anything that monitors your movements after you leave me. BUT, if you prefer not to have cookies enabled, then please… set your browser to disable them before using the site. Some things might look a little strange but you’ll still be able to use the site!

Email and Personal Information Collected By Direct ebook Purchases from Payhip
If you buy ebooks directly from me via Payhip, the email collected from you is used by Payhip to deliver a link to download your ebook. Your email address is also added to a list at Payhip which is used to send you information about the purchase you just made.
Additionally, when you make a direct ebook purchase, your email will be added to one of my “Donna McDonald” mailing lists — I Love Romantic Comedy (contemporary) or the I Love Paranormal Books (paranormal/sci-fi/fantasy). I will use your email address to send information about my store sales as well as new book releases.
You are free to unsubscribe from any of the Donna McDonald lists at any time. However, please keep in mind that Payhip will add you back when future purchases are made because a valid email address is a necessary requirement for buying directly. It is used to deliver your ebook to you and to track your purchase of the ebook.
Any snail address information collected from you by Payhip is used for tax purposes. Payhip handles all financial transactions on my behalf, including credit card payments via Stripe and Paypal purchases. All inquiries about failed transactions should go through them.
